// about the game

ZOO or OOF is a round-based hide-and-seek party game on Roblox. Every match, most players become animals hiding among NPC wildlife scattered across zoo enclosures while one unlucky player gets picked as the zookeeper — their job is to find and tranquilize every hidden player before the timer runs out. If even one animal survives, the zookeeper loses.

The game leans into slapstick energy. Your animal might be holding perfectly still as a flamingo while the zookeeper walks right past, only to panic and run straight into a wall the second they turn around. It's the kind of party game that generates stories you tell your friends about afterward.

// how a round plays

Rounds are fast — usually 3 to 5 minutes. Structure:

  1. Lobby phase. Players vote on the map. Highest vote wins.
  2. Role assignment. One player becomes zookeeper. Everyone else is assigned a random animal (unless using a skin from shop).
  3. Grace period. Animals spawn with a few seconds to pick a hiding spot before the zookeeper can move.
  4. Main round. Animals hide, zookeeper patrols with tranq rifle. Tagged animals become spectators.
  5. Round end. Either the timer runs out (animals win) or everyone is tagged (zookeeper wins).
  6. Next round. Back to lobby. New map vote, new roles.
// asymmetric win condition The zookeeper loses if even one animal survives. That single rule drives everything — it makes hiders only need to be better than the worst player, and makes zookeepers hunt thoroughly even when the clock is almost out.

// taunt economy

In-game currency (coins) unlocks cosmetics. Two earning methods:

taunting (animals)

Animals have a taunt emote that awards coins. The catch: taunting visually highlights your position briefly. Too much taunting gets you tagged. Too little means you earn nothing.

Meta sweet spot: taunt right after the zookeeper walks past your hiding spot. They've already cleared your area and won't backtrack soon. You earn coins safely while they move on.

eliminations (zookeeper)

Every player you tag gives you coins. Winning the round gives a bonus. Losing means partial earnings, so lazy zookeeping costs you.

// private server warning Coin earnings are disabled in private servers. If you're grinding for cosmetics, play public matches only.

// strategy guide

as animal — the first 10 seconds

Sprint to a pre-planned spot. Don't stand in open areas picking one mid-round — the zookeeper catches you moving. Learn 3-4 reliable spots per map before worrying about wins.

as animal — blend with NPCs

Stand near NPCs of your species. Match their idle animation — face the same direction, don't move when they're still. Zookeepers scan a group and pick off the one that's subtly wrong.

as animal — crouch strategically

Crouching hides you better but marks you as a player (NPCs don't crouch). Use only when the zookeeper is close. Don't make it permanent.

as animal — taunt timing

Taunt the moment the zookeeper walks away from your enclosure. That's your 20-30 second window.

as animal — control panic

The #1 reason animals get tagged is panic. Zookeeper walks near you, you run — but running is what flags you. Stand still. NPCs don't flee. Hold your ground and you pass as NPC more often than you think.

as zookeeper — prioritize big targets

Large animals (elephants, giraffes, lions) are easier to spot. Eliminate them first to clean up the map.

as zookeeper — watch movement mismatches

NPCs follow set routes. Animals facing wrong, standing oddly, or hesitating are players. Imperfect imitation is the tell.

as zookeeper — don't waste darts

Limited ammo, reload time. Aim carefully. Missed shots give targets a head-start.

as zookeeper — slow patrol wins

Running past hiders misses them. Slow walking gives your eyes time to scan and your mind time to process anomalies.

// advanced tips

Mirror NPC idle cycles. Watch an NPC of your species for 5 seconds before hiding near them. Copy their head movement and step pattern. Most players stay too still — NPCs actually shuffle every few seconds.
Don't sprint as animal. Sprint triggers an animation NPCs never do. If the zookeeper is even casually watching, sprinting flags you.
Memorize line-of-sight corners. Every map has spots where the zookeeper's view gets blocked. Know 2-3 per map for quick relocates.
As zookeeper, walk don't run. Running past hiders wastes opportunities. Walk and scan.
Don't camp twice in a row. If you survived a round hiding behind the penguin rocks, the zookeeper checks there first next round. Rotate.
Join public servers 8+ players. More animals = more decoys. Private servers disable earnings anyway.
Use the minimap. Player markers sometimes flicker briefly during events. Unreliable but occasionally wins rounds.

ZOO or OOF sits in the lightest corner of the hide-and-seek genre. Flee the Facility is puzzle-focused. Murder Mystery 2 is competitive and faster. ZOO or OOF is the chill social version where you goof around with friends without getting stressed.
